During a visit intended at repairing tense relations, Treasury Secretary Janet Yellen urged China’s No. 2 leader not to allow displeasure about U.S. restrictions on access to processor chips and other technologies undermine economic cooperation.

During a meeting with Premier Li Qiang, Yellen stated that Washington and Beijing must work together on global concerns. She urged “regular channels of communication” at a time when ties are at an all-time low owing to disagreements over technology, security, and other irritants.

Yellen is one of several senior US officials who will travel to Beijing to push Chinese authorities to rekindle relations between the world’s two largest economies.
